How to select the best newborn photographer in Kolkata

From one mother to another—here’s what to look for

Choosing a newborn photographer isn’t just about finding someone with a good camera. It’s about trust. It’s about instinct. And—more than anything—it’s about comfort.

Your baby is just days old. You’re still learning each other. Feeding patterns are wobbly. Naps are unpredictable. Everything feels new. Which means the last thing you want is a shoot that adds more stress to your already sleep-deprived day.

So how do you pick the right newborn photographer in Kolkata?

Let’s walk through it—gently.

1. Experience matters—but not just behind the lens

Newborn photography isn’t like event or fashion photography. It requires an entirely different kind of skill. The best newborn photographers understand how to hold, soothe, swaddle, and pose a baby safely—and with care.

Look for someone who has been working with babies for years, not just months. And if they’re a parent themselves, that’s not just a bonus—it’s a quiet superpower.

As a mother and someone who’s spent over a decade photographing newborns, I know how to listen to your baby’s cues—and yours. I understand the sleepy feeds, the unexpected cries, the way a tiny sigh can mean not now, please. I’ve held countless babies in that delicate, in-between stage—and I’ve held my own too.

There’s no shortcut to that kind of knowing.

2. The space should feel calm, clean—and ready for real life

You’ll want a studio that’s quiet, temperature-controlled, and baby-friendly. Natural light or soft studio lighting. Cozy wraps. Clean props.

But also: a comfortable bedroom setup for you to nurse, cuddle, or just rest your back. And yes—an attached toilet is a small but very welcome detail in those early postpartum weeks.

Spaciousness matters, both physically and emotionally.

3. Patience isn’t a perk—it’s the job description

Feeding breaks. Nappy changes. Unexpected cries. Sometimes, all in the same minute.

The best newborn photographers don’t just “allow” for this—they expect it. The shoot isn’t rushed. There’s no pressure. Just time to let the baby be a baby.

So ask them: What happens if my baby needs a feed halfway through? (The right answer: You pause, of course.)

4. Style, tone, and feeling

Every photographer has a style. Some are whimsical and colourful. Some are minimalist. Some love props, others prefer simplicity.

Browse their portfolio. Do the images feel staged or natural? Can you feel something when you look at them? And just as importantly—can you imagine your baby in them?

5. Gut feel counts

You’re going to be handing over your days-old baby to someone—often for hours. So yes, gut instinct counts.

Do they make you feel safe? Do they listen when you talk? Do they understand your baby’s cues?

That soft voice, that knowing glance, that willingness to wait until the baby is ready—those are things you can’t Photoshop in.

A mother’s guide to finding the right newborn photographer

From safety to style: 10 things to look for in a newborn photographer


Your baby’s first photo shoot isn’t just about pictures; it’s about freezing those precious, fleeting moments. 

From their teeny-tiny toes to that adorable yawn, you want a photographer who can capture it all with care, creativity, and a dash of magic. 


Here are 10 tips to help you choose someone who’ll make it happen effortlessly.

1. Stalk their portfolio like it’s your favorite influencer’s Insta feed

Scroll through their photos. If their work doesn’t make your heart melt faster than a gooey chocolate fondant, keep looking.

2. Check reviews, because fellow moms don’t sugarcoat

Read testimonials from other parents. If they’re raving about the experience, that’s your sign.

3. Look at their editing style—is it elegant or over the top?

Subtlety is key. You want timeless, beautiful photos, not something that looks flagrantly fake.

4. Do they look like someone who loves babies (or just tolerates them)?

If the photographer seems more excited about their lens than your baby, it’s a red flag. 

5. If they offer too-good-to-be-true prices, run faster than a toddler with a cookie

Quality matters. Photography is art, not a discount rack. Cheap rates often mean they’re still learning—or their editing software is Paint 3D.

6. Props are great, but avoid a circus

Props should enhance the moment, not steal the show. A tasteful blanket is better than a life-sized stuffed giraffe.

7. Are they flexible enough to handle nap time shenanigans?

Babies run on their own schedules, and a good photographer works around that without batting an eye.

8. Location matters: Is it cozy and well-lit?

Find out where they shoot and if the space is baby-friendly. Bonus points for comfortable seating for sleep-deprived parents.

9. Can they handle fussy babies, or the inevitable baby pee/poo incidents?

From outfit changes to extra props, a good photographer is ready for all the messy surprises your little one can bring.

10. Trust your instincts: Do they feel like the right fit?”

At the end of the day, you need someone you’re happy and comfortable with. If it feels right, go for it.

Choosing a newborn photographer is about finding someone who understands the beauty of this fleeting time. 

With the right person, you’ll walk away with beautiful memories that make you teary-eyed … even years from now. 

Take your time, trust your gut, and let the magic happen.
